Why was the flying scene cut from the Rocky Mountain Holiday release?
August 7th, 2007

When John Denver unexpectedly died on October 12, 1997 due to a flying accident, this tragedy sent shockwaves throughout the entertainment industry. Out of respect for his family and friends, the following flying scene was edited out of the 2003 DVD and VHS release of this special. John and Rowlf are flying above the Colorado Rockies in a plane. John is performing one stunt after another in order to cure Rowlf’s hiccups. Since John loved to fly, there is some debate whether or not this scene should have been cut.
